Coronation Street actor Simon Gregson has previously spoken about how he believes his house is haunted and has now been called in by paranormal experts.
The star who plays Steve McDonald in the ITV soap will reunite with ghost hunter Barri Ghai, psychic medium Ian Lawman and paranormal investigator Jayne Harris on Discovery+ Celebrities help! My house is haunted.
Speaking of the reality show, said Gregson TV times magazine: “My wife Emma, my eldest son Alfie and I saw a woman dressed in white walking across the landing by the stairs.

“Once, around 1:30 a.m., I saw him pass by. At first I thought it was Emma returning from a night out with friends.
“When I called to ask if it was her, she replied, ‘No, you’re going to tell me you saw a woman walk across the landing, right?’ I saw her too!
He explained that he wanted experts to find out who the ghosts were by looking at the history of the house and the neighborhood, and hopefully get rid of them.
“As soon as the team set up their equipment, they picked up the voices of the spirits,” he said.

“They discovered that in the late 19th century, a woman named Sarah Ann, her child, and Susanna’s mother were murdered near our home by Susanna’s husband and Sarah Ann’s stepfather, William.
“Sarah Ann had a child out of wedlock and the women were found wearing nightgowns and our home is in the old brickyard where William worked.
“Ian thought the woman in white was Sarah Ann. It was surprising because it’s a scary story.”
The actor also told the publication that there had been no sightings since the experts visited the house.
